Make wrappers small again (#2243)
* introduce --debug option to abi-gen and remove debug functions from @0x/abi-gen-wrappers * make evmExecAsync protected; ignore deployedBytecode in doc comment * trim deployedBytecode so it's undefined unless a contract has pure functions * remove validateAndSendTransactionAsync * Create `AwaitTransactionSuccessOpts` and `SendTransactionOpts` types * Remove duplicate types `IndexedFilterValues`, `DecodedLogEvent`, `EventCallback` from `@0x/base-contract`
